Roosendaal, North Brabant, Netherlands

Overview

Roosendaal is a busy city in North Brabant, Netherlands, blending rich local heritage with modern amenities. It offers a pleasant mix of shopping, parks, and cultural attractions in a compact, walkable setting. The city is well-connected by rail, making it a convenient base for exploring the region.

Best Time to Visit

April-June and September offer mild weather and fewer crowds.

Local Tips

Biking is popular and safe, so consider renting a bicycle to explore local neighborhoods. Most shops close early on Sundays; plan errands accordingly.

Cultural Etiquette

Tipping is not mandatory but appreciated in restaurants (around 5-10%). Dress casually, but neatness is valued. Greetings are friendly and courteous, usually with a handshake.

Safety Warnings

Roosendaal is generally safe, but exercise caution around the train station late at night due to occasional petty theft. Beware of pickpockets in crowded shopping areas.

Hidden Gems

Visit the Tongerlohuys Museum for local history, explore the woodland trails in Visdonk, and check out neighborhood bakeries for authentic Dutch pastries.
